| 0:33.0 | Meet this philosopher and former monk, |
| 0:36.0 | now a husband and father of two daughters, |
| 0:38.0 | and hear what happens when the ancient tradition |
| 0:41.0 | embodied in the Dalai Lama meets science and life. |
| 0:45.0 | One thing that I cherish about the experience of translating for him |
| 0:50.0 | is the joyful state of mind I can automatically get into. |
| 0:56.0 | But when I try to cultivate that state of mind |
| 0:59.0 | in my own quiet sitting meditation, it's tougher. |
| 1:02.0 | And this is of course a tremendous source of energy and enthusiasm. |
| 1:07.0 | And also it's a constant reminder to me that ordinary people can strive |
| 1:12.0 | to that kind of state of mind, |
| 1:14.0 | so that I find most transformative. |
